Developing for Views 7.3 API

Intended audience: 
Intermediate

Topics

In this session, module developers will receive an introduction to the Views 7.3 API:

  • API overview
  • embedding Views in code
  • defining default Views
  • declaring new tables to Views
    • standalone tables
    • tables joined to other existing tables
    • fields: real, virtual
    • altering existing definitions
  • Writing handlers (intro)
  • Writing plugins (intro)

Code samples

  • declaring Views integration
  • declaring a base table (View type)
  • defining a code-based (default) View
  • writing an Access plugin
  • writing an Area handler

Prerequisites / Limitations

Attendees should be knowledgeable about module writing and about Views UI use.

Not covered due to limited time: in-depth treatment of advanced field techniques, query altering, various handler and plugin types, themeing, noSQL views, i18n in views.

Following dereine's previous presentation on Views 7.3 is warmly recommended.
